How To Fix TRS0098 - Enter factor values for date &1 before posting


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: TRS0 - Messages for Reconciliation

  • Message number: 098

  • Message text: Enter factor values for date &1 before posting

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    Factor values are missing on the specific date(s).

    System Response

    How to fix this error?


    Enter factor values for all the missing date(s) using the <LS>Enter
    Factor Values</> app.
    Run the <LS>Update Planned Records for Securities</> app to update the
    position flows.
    Start the <LS>Run Accrual/Deferral</> app if your process schedules it.
    You can then run the <LS>Automatic Debit Position and Posting -
    Securities Accounts</> app again.

    Enter factor values for all the missing date(s) using the <LS>Enter
    Factor Values</> function (transaction <NP>TMDFACTORVAL</>).
    Run the <LS>Update Planned Records</> function (transaction <NP>FWUP</>)
    to update the position flows.
    Start the <LS>Execute Accrual/Deferral</> function (transaction
    <NP>TPM44</>) if your process schedules it.
    You can then run the <LS>Automatic Debit Position</> function
    (transaction <NP>FWSO</>) again.

    The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message TRS0098 - Enter factor values for date &1 before posting ?

    The SAP error message TRS0098, which states "Enter factor values for date &1 before posting," typically occurs in the context of Treasury and Risk Management (TRM) when dealing with transactions that require specific factor values for a given date. This error indicates that the system expects certain input values (factors) to be provided for the specified date before the transaction can be posted.

    Cause:

    The error is usually caused by one of the following reasons:

    1. Missing Factor Values: The required factor values for the specified date have not been entered in the system. These values are often necessary for calculations related to interest, currency conversion, or other financial metrics.
    2. Incorrect Date: The date specified may not have corresponding factor values defined in the system.
    3. Configuration Issues: There may be configuration settings in the Treasury module that are not set up correctly, leading to the requirement for factor values not being met.

    Solution:

    To resolve the TRS0098 error, you can take the following steps:

    1. Check Factor Values:

      • Navigate to the relevant transaction or configuration area in SAP where factor values are maintained.
      • Ensure that the factor values for the specified date are entered correctly. This may involve checking interest rates, currency exchange rates, or other relevant financial factors.
    2. Enter Missing Values:

      • If the factor values are missing, enter them for the specified date. This may involve creating or updating records in the relevant tables or transaction codes.
    3. Verify Date:

      • Confirm that the date you are trying to post against is correct and that it falls within the range of dates for which factor values are defined.
    4. Consult Documentation:

      • Review SAP documentation or help resources related to Treasury and Risk Management to understand the specific requirements for factor values.
    5. Check Configuration:

      • If you suspect a configuration issue, consult with your SAP Basis or functional consultant to ensure that the Treasury module is configured correctly.
    6. Testing:

      • After entering the necessary factor values, attempt to post the transaction again to see if the error persists.
